Motorola Solutions, Inc. (NYSE:MSI – Get Free Report) declared a quarterly dividend on Wednesday, August 19th. Stockholders of record on Wednesday, September 16th will be given a dividend of 1.21 per share by the communications equipment provider on Thursday, October 15th. This represents a c) ann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 1.0%. The ex-dividend date is Wednesday, September 16th.
Motorola Solutions has increased its dividend payment by an average of 0.1%per year over the last three years and has raised its dividend every year for the last 13 years. Motorola Solutions has a dividend payout ratio of 30.4% meaning its dividend is sufficiently covered by earnings. Analysts expect Motorola Solutions to earn $17.03 per share next year, which means the company should continue to be able to cover its $4.84 annual dividend with an expected future payout ratio of 28.4%.

Motorola Solutions Company Profile
Motorola Solutions, Inc develops mission-critical communications and technology solutions for public safety organizations, government agencies and commercial enterprises. Its offerings include land mobile radio systems, broadband communications, command-center software, computer-aided dispatch, records management, evidence management and emergency call-handling technologies.
The company also provides video security and access-control solutions, including body-worn cameras, in-car video systems, fixed video surveillance and related analytics.
